Electrical Foreperson

4 months ago


Nanaimo, Canada Mazzei Electric Full time

Mazzei Electric started in Nanaimo, BC in . We started as a small family run company that focused on commercial service contracts. We now have a variety of multi-family residential, commercial, institutional, and light industrial projects across the province, complimented by our service departments that offer residential and commercial service and maintenance. We currently operate across Vancouver Island, throughout the Okanagan, and in Northern BC.

Why work here? You will be part of a growing team that is proud, dedicated, and still stays true to the family-run company feeling. When we ask our employees why they like working here, the #1 answer is always the people. Our team is knowledgeable, safety focused, and the comradery is second to none.

Mazzei Electric offers a competitive salary, extensive health and dental benefits that we pay the premiums for, RRSP matching, paid training and development, recognition programs, an annual apprentice scholarship, fun staff events, opportunities for advancement, and a safe and inclusive work environment. We also have a growing Employee Perks program that includes discounts on vehicle repair/parts, retail stores, and gym memberships.

We have won numerous awards including Victoria’s #1 Best Electrician, Nanaimo’s Best Electrical Contractor, VICA’s Employer of the Year, BCCA Builder’s Code Contractor of the Year, VICA’s Safety Excellence Award, and have been named as one of Canada’s Fastest Growing Companies.

We are currently hiring for Electrical Foreperson Electricians in Nanaimo, BC and the surrounding areas. Compensation for this role is between $42/hour and $44/hour, immediate health and dental benefits, and RRSP matching after one year. When you factor these together the total compensation is between $45.01/hour and $47.07/hour

Responsibilities

Plan, organize, direct, and control daily operations including completion of work scope, ensuring the use of company OHS policies and procedures, and on-site inventory management Plan and prepare construction schedules and monitor progress Reading and interpreting drawings and schematics Coordinate with the site coordinators or general superintendents Professionalism in client/contractor relations Installation and troubleshooting of all electrical components in multi-family residential, commercial and institutional structures Follow safety programs and policies, wear appropriate PPE, and attend safety training as required Present a positive, can-do attitude in the workplace and with our clients Instruction and leadership of apprentices and journeypersons Punctual and reliable presence on worksites Understanding of Arc Flash and Lock-out/Tag-out procedures

Qualifications

Red-Seal Journeyperson Certificate 5 years electrical experience required in multi-family residential/commercial sectors Strong supervisory and leadership skills Basic computer skills including Microsoft Office Valid Class B FSR or higher an asset Extensive knowledge of CEC Commercial/residential construction experience required Experience in all other electrical fields are an asset Basic hand tools and cordless power tools Valid class 5 driver’s license preferred Willing to work out of town, longer shifts, and/or evening shifts.
